From there came an idea which she has turned into a transparent business together with Jane Chung who has over 20 years of experience at Donna Karen. While on sabbatical from her former job, Vanessa was learning about sustainable finance which lead her to the problematic influence of the fashion industry on the environment. The founder, Vanessa Barboni Hallick, left a thriving career in finance at Morgan Stanley to create a startup based on human, animal and environmental welfare.
